K366 MGP is a 1993 Ford Sierra in Blue with a 1,593c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60.9%.
Across all 1993 Ford Sierra models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.6% with a typical mileage of 51,864 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ford Sierra fails its MOT is su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 24,833 recorded failures. If you're considering buying K366 MGP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Sierra typically stays on UK roads for around 43 years. At 33 years old, this Ford Sierra is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
